{"api_version":"1","generated_at":"2026-08-28T14:29:39+00:00","cve":"CVE-2026-80660","urls":{"html":"https://cve.report/CVE-2026-80660","api":"https://cve.report/api/cve/CVE-2026-80660.json","docs":"https://cve.report/api","cve_org":"https://www.cve.org/CVERecord?id=CVE-2026-80660","nvd":"https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2026-80660"},"summary":{"title":"hwmon: (occ) unregister sysfs devices outside occ lock","description":"In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:\n\nhwmon: (occ) unregister sysfs devices outside occ lock\n\nocc_active(false) and occ_shutdown() unregister sysfs-backed devices while\nocc->lock is held.  hwmon_device_unregister() and sysfs_remove_group() can\nwait for active sysfs callbacks to drain, and those callbacks can enter the\nOCC update path and try to take occ->lock again.  That gives the unregister\npaths the lock ordering occ->lock -> sysfs callback drain, while a callback\nhas the opposite edge sysfs callback -> occ->lock.\n\nThis issue was found by our static analysis tool and then manually\nreviewed against the current tree.\n\nThe grounded PoC kept the real unregister and callback carrier:\n\n  occ_shutdown()\n  hwmon_device_unregister()\n  occ_show_temp_1()\n  occ_update_response()\n\nLockdep reported the circular dependency with occ_shutdown() already\nholding the OCC mutex and hwmon_device_unregister() waiting on the sysfs\nside:\n\n  WARNING: possible circular locking dependency detected\n  ... (sysfs_lock) ... at: hwmon_device_unregister+0x12/0x30 [vuln_msv]\n  ... (&test_occ.lock) ... at: occ_shutdown.constprop.0+0xe/0x40 [vuln_msv]\n  occ_update_response.isra.0+0xb/0x20 [vuln_msv]\n  occ_show_temp_1.constprop.0.isra.0+0x23/0x40 [vuln_msv]\n  *** DEADLOCK ***\n\nSerialize hwmon registration and removal with a separate hwmon_lock.\nUnder that lock, detach occ->hwmon and update occ->active while occ->lock\nis held so concurrent OCC state changes still see a stable state, then\ndrop occ->lock before calling hwmon_device_unregister().  Remove the\ndriver sysfs group before taking occ->lock in occ_shutdown(), so draining\nthe driver attributes cannot wait while the OCC mutex is held.  Also make\nOCC update callbacks return -ENODEV after deactivation, so callbacks that\nalready passed sysfs active protection do not poll the hardware after\nteardown has detached the hwmon device.","state":"PUBLISHED","assigner":"Linux","published_at":"2026-08-28 08:16:51","updated_at":"2026-08-28
